ホームページ >ウェブフロントエンド >CSSチュートリアル >CSS ファイルをリンクするために絶対パスと相対パスを選択するにはどうすればよいですか?

CSS ファイルをリンクするために絶対パスと相対パスを選択するにはどうすればよいですか?

Barbara Streisand
Barbara Streisandオリジナル
2024-11-30 09:23:11709ブラウズ

How to Choose Between Absolute and Relative Paths for Linking CSS Files?

CSS ファイルへの相対パス

Web アプリケーションで CSS ファイルを参照する場合、スタイルが正しく適用されるように正しいパスを指定することが重要です。

絶対と相対を理解するパス

  • 絶対パスは、ホスト名のルートを示すスラッシュ「/」で始まります。
  • 相対パス現在の URL から開始location.

CSS ディレクトリのルートの指定

この場合、CSS ディレクトリはプロジェクト フォルダーのルートにあります。正しいパスを指定するには、

1 の 2 つのオプションがあります。絶対パス:

<link rel="stylesheet" type="text/css" href="/css/styles.css"/>

このパスは、プロジェクトのルートがホスト名の直下にあることを前提としています。たとえば、Web サイトが http://mywebsite.com にある場合、このパスは機能します。

2.相対パス:

<link rel="stylesheet" type="text/css" href="css/styles.css"/>

このパスは、CSS ファイルが、CSS ファイルを含める HTML ファイルと同じディレクトリにあることを前提としています。CSS ディレクトリはプロジェクトのルートにあるため、これはパスも

考慮事項:

  • CSS ディレクトリを移動するか、URL の /ServletApp/ 部分を削除する予定がある場合、絶対パスはさらに大きくなります。
  • CSS ファイルが常に HTML ファイルと同じディレクトリに配置される場合は、相対パスの方が効率的です。

以上がCSS ファイルをリンクするために絶対パスと相対パスを選択する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。